Maher confirms Another Wil shift

Another Wil heads to Sir Rupert Clarke after Memsie setback

Another Wil will not run in Saturday’s Group 1 Makybe Diva Stakes at Flemington, with trainer Ciaron Maher instead targeting the Group 1 Sir Rupert Clarke Stakes at Caulfield a week later.

Maher confirmed the change in plans after Another Wil’s unplaced performance in the Memsie Stakes late last month.

Sent out favourite, the gelding faded to finish sixth, beaten six lengths by Treasurethe Moment.

“That run bothered me a little bit,” Maher told racing.com. “We’ll give him that extra week, that’s probably the main thing, to bring him on a little more, and another run at the 1400 will only be to his benefit.”

Maher said the gelding had returned from a spell slightly bigger and was expected to need the run first-up, but Maher admitted he was surprised by the margin of defeat and noted Another Wil’s head carriage late in the Memsie.

“Hopefully it’s just fitness, but it was a bit of a worry,” he said.

The decision to hold off for the Rupert Clarke gives Another Wil three weeks between runs instead of two.

“Two weeks is tough anyway, so the extra week will help,” Maher said. “Just that run under the belt and he’s had a few good pieces of work since.”
